TWH may be locked down temporarily in a limbo of nightmare and the poison may be in the perfume called air, but our spirit floats on in a different form, pressed into a 12'' black vinyl inside a white label EP called ACID ZOO.
Through the bars of ACID ZOO you will hear 3 tracks - THE ICKE AGE, BLACK POOL & THE NATIONAL + - and 4 remixes by Leyland Kirby (The Caretaker), Richard Fearless, Lille Cykel (Posh Isolation) and Christoph de Babalon.
Tragically fractured like the screen of a dropped phone, THE NATIONAL + is the BSDs new 'thing' - a 7-minute symphony of absurdity and raw imagination - set outside WILKO and inside TESCO'S CHAINSAW MASSACRE.
